Candidates seeking SCOER Pune BTech admission have to submit the important documents. These are required to verify that the selected students meet the eligibility criteria. Candidates should keep the document copies and originals with them. The list of documents required during admission is provided below:
- CAP allotment letter
- ARC confirmation letter
- SSC marksheet
- HSC leaving certificate
- Nationality and domicile certificate
- MHT-CET/ JEE scorecard
- Caste certificate
- Caste validity/ tribe certificate
- Non creamy layer certificate
- Income certificate
- Ration card
- Aadhaar card

NCL is issued for the individual of OBC categories whose annual income falls below 8 Lacs and whose parents do not hold certain high ranking government position. So there are no specific types of NCL certificates. Any OBC meeting the above criteria can be eligible for NCL certificate.
